Gostaria de saber se os colegas que programam em Java, fazem isso com uma espécie de “cola” ao lado, seja um livro ou anotações em papel(meu caso), ou sem usar nada, apenas 100% da memória.
Pergunto isso pois as vezes acho que ainda não sei nada de Java pois usso muito minhas anotações (em folhas de papel mesmo) para me auxiliar em alguns projetos mais complexos.
Sempre em caso de não saber alguma sintaxe, consulto um livro ou pdf. Papel uso mais para esboçar alguma lógica de negócio…
T
thingol
Outro cara que acha que “saber == decorar”?
Tenha dó. Consulte à vontade; consultar a informação correta e fazer as coisas direito (sem ficar chutando*) é o correto.
Se cortarem meu acesso à Internet, aos javadocs etc. eu não consigo fazer absolutamente nada.
E isso que faz uns 10 anos que conheço o Java
A palavra “chutar” para designar “palpite sem nenhum conhecimento” é bastante infeliz. Um jogador de futebol profissional chuta muito, mas sabe exatamente o que está fazendo todo o tempo.
D
didiosam
erickles wrote:
Sempre em caso de não saber alguma sintaxe, consulto um livro ou pdf. Papel uso mais para esboçar alguma lógica de negócio…
tb faço isso, consulto pdfs, foruns e antes de td o oraculo: google …
FabricioPJ
Bom saber…
Não gosto de decorar… por isso criei este tópico.
Pensei que era o único.
Sempre ando com minhas anotações… o que escrevo nelas é geralmente dicas ou coisas importantes que devem sempre estar por perto.
Agradeço as opiniões até o momento.
peczenyj
Por vezes eu imprimo algumas coisas e coloco por perto para poder olhar, consultar ou me inspirar.
aleck
eu tenho um wiki
antonioni.rocha
Geralmente uso para alguns esboços básicos e/ou de alta abstração, ou quando tenho uma idéia e não estou no PC. De resto vou logo com a mão na massa…
Andre_Brito
Você também é adepto do “Dijkstra is watching”? O que mais usam aí na gcom?
Tchello
Além de consultar a documentação on-line e foruns, listas, etc não abro mão de jeito nenhum da minha prancheta com uma folha em branco pra testes de mesa.
Costumo organizar meus pensamentos pra algumas parte mais “complexas” antes de começar a codificar, me ajuda a pensar mais claramente e faço mais rapidamente.
De fato, pra cada projeto que faço tenho trocentas folhas rabiscadas (pra mim não são rabiscos) de tanto esboço, além da documentação de prache.
Abraços!
Tchello
Você também é adepto do “Dijkstra is watching”? O que mais usam aí na gcom?
Hhaha essa é muito boa!
Preciso imprimir uma dessas pra por aqui no trab novo.
Imprimir algumas páginas de consulta rápida costumam ajudar tbm.
Abraços.
Michel_Sancovich
++
D
DaniloAl
Decorar nem é a questão,decorar é diferente de aprender e fazer institivamente.Por exemplo,quando se está aprendendo banco de dados.
Quando vc ver por exemplo o join,de inicio vc pensa : “é,tenho que pegar as tabelas, dá um ‘apelido’( funcionario func… : )),e fazer isso e aquilo…”,depois de certo tempo,vc observa que já faz institivamente,isso não quer dizer que vc decorou,e sim aprendeu.
Quanto às consultas,vc pode fazer tranquilamente,realmente sem o google é impossível.Outra coisa que torna impossível o trabalho na nossa area,é trabalhar sem estar sempre
questionando aos outros integrantes da equipe,aqui tudo que não sabemos perguntamos um ao outro,a comunicação é indispesável…
mario.fts
Trabalhei em uma empresa que bloqueava todo o acesso a internet (até o google).
Só comecei a ter alguma produtividade quando baixei os docs do java pro pendrive pra ter o que consultar…
mas pra qualquer coisa mais avançada era muito f***.
mario.fts
Só pra complementar e não fugir do tópico, eu rabisco quase tudo que eu vou fazer antes, como o pessoal que postou antes… agora o resto é só no google e javadocs.
[]'s
D
djemacao
Se retirarem o Google, esqueço até o que significa Java .
Bom, brincadeiras a parte, decorar não é a melhor solução para se saber programar em uma linguagem. A pesquisa é fundamental para fazer não só funcionar, mas melhor. E mais, idéias surgem, de trechos de códigos ou de comentários que vc nem imaginava antes. Por isso, seja como for, sem consulta, não dá.
FabricioPJ
Acho que vou adotar essa idéia de rabiscar meus pensamentos antes de codificar… parece ser bem útil.
JA me encontrei em situações em que tive uma ideia de como resolver um determinado problema, mas deixei para segundo plano pois estava codificando algo mais importante, daí, quando retomei meus pensamentos sobre aquele problema, minha idéia já havia sumido.
mario.fts
FabricioPJ:
Acho que vou adotar essa idéia de rabiscar meus pensamentos antes de codificar… parece ser bem útil.
JA me encontrei em situações em que tive uma ideia de como resolver um determinado problema, mas deixei para segundo plano pois estava codificando algo mais importante, daí, quando retomei meus pensamentos sobre aquele problema, minha idéia já havia sumido.
huauhauhauhauha parace eu…
D
djemacao
Nem só rabiscar, ter um bom e sempre possível, favoritos.
Eu tenho mais de 13000 páginas em meus favoritos. Se não fizessem esse firefox pesquisar bem isso, eu tava lascado. Isso é importantíssimo para agilizar idéias. Sempre que encontrar uma coisa, pode ser menos importante agora, ou até mesmo interessante mas sem importância pro seu trabalho atual, guarde. Um dia vc precisa, acredite.
peczenyj
Isso me faz lembrar que tem anos que eu não escrevo uma pagina inteira com uma caneta ou lapis.
arvis
Procuro trabalhar sempre com um editor de texto aberto para ir anotando idéias, além de livros e o bom e velho bookmark. Costumo usar papel apenas para esboçar as idéias ou como fazer algo… planejar um solução.
Acredito que o conhecimento gira em torno de saber onde e como procurar um determinado assunto ou soluções de problemas. Ex: fóruns, google, livro, etc.
[]'s
mario.fts
[OFF-TOPIC]
Em algumas entrevistas pedem pra vc fazer uma redação. Vc vai lá, e escreve miseras 25 linhas… e parece que vc escreveu um livro inteiro, e a mão chega até a doer…
sinais dos tempos… :twisted:
[/OFF-TOPIC]
V
victorhsn
Anoto sempre, desenho sempre.
josenaldo
[OFF-TOPIC]
Em algumas entrevistas pedem pra vc fazer uma redação. Vc vai lá, e escreve miseras 25 linhas… e parece que vc escreveu um livro inteiro, e a mão chega até a doer…
sinais dos tempos… :twisted:
[/OFF-TOPIC]
E eu achando que estava sozinho… Daqui a pouco vou ter q escrever um software pra decodificar minha letra… rssrsr
aleck
Vamos criar uma comunidade “Não sei mais escrever no papel”. 8)
Voltando ao topico, eu tenho um certo pavor de utilizar papel e caneta, costumo fazer tudo eletronicamente, a natureza agradece
RodyBr
Não vejo problemas de realizar anotações em papel e caneta, desde que voce tenha cuidado de registrar corretamente as informações úteis (em outras palavras, documentar!), para que não virem “papel de pão” do projeto. :lol:
Agora pra provocar: alguém faz teste de mesa por aqui utilizando papel e caneta (lápis é melhor)? :lol:
FabricioPJ
Eu, basicamente, só faço anotações no papel, pois escrevo mais rápico com a caneta do que no teclado.
E parece que escrevendo com a caneta, você aprende melhor do que no teclado… pelo menos comigo.
Tchello
mario.fts:
Trabalhei em uma empresa que bloqueava todo o acesso a internet (até o google).
Só comecei a ter alguma produtividade quando baixei os docs do java pro pendrive pra ter o que consultar…
mas pra qualquer coisa mais avançada era muito f***.
GANHEI!
Trabalhei em uma empresa onde EU (estagiario!) era a equipe inteira e tinha que fazer tudo sozinho.
SEM internet(tudo bloqueado, e era uma grande empresa que fabrica dispositivos de telecomunicações).
SEM pendrive (era proibido, mas eu dava um jeito).
Acharam que se contratassem um estagiario ele se viraria sozinho pra fazer o “sisteminha” deles.
Foi uma b* de estagio, acreditem. Se eu soubesse desde o principio que seria aquilo eu nao teria aceito.
mario.fts
pior: faço maquinas de estado pra navegação. :roll:
fredferrao
FabricioPJ:
Acho que vou adotar essa idéia de rabiscar meus pensamentos antes de codificar… parece ser bem útil.
JA me encontrei em situações em que tive uma ideia de como resolver um determinado problema, mas deixei para segundo plano pois estava codificando algo mais importante, daí, quando retomei meus pensamentos sobre aquele problema, minha idéia já havia sumido.
Eu anoto no papel na hora, pra nao perder a idéia, até quando estou deitado pra dormir e vem a idéia eu corro pra anotar!
Tenho sempre o Javadoc baixado na maquina, e de resto é google, papel apenas para logicas, idéias e rabiscos.
LPJava
uso papel para desenhar logica, e as vezes desenhar o problema tb.
Mais uso o materiais em pdf, o java doc, o google, guj,javaranch
R
RafaelViana
fredferrao:
Acho que vou adotar essa idéia de rabiscar meus pensamentos antes de codificar… parece ser bem útil.
JA me encontrei em situações em que tive uma ideia de como resolver um determinado problema, mas deixei para segundo plano pois estava codificando algo mais importante, daí, quando retomei meus pensamentos sobre aquele problema, minha idéia já havia sumido.
Eu anoto no papel na hora, pra nao perder a idéia, até quando estou deitado pra dormir e vem a idéia eu corro pra anotar! ²